Merge pull request from GHSA-4w53-6jvp-gg52
* feat: Add support for allowed proxy addresses

This commit adds support for allowed proxy addresses, which allows only connections from these IP ranges to send a proxy header based on the PROXY protocol. If the allowed proxy addresses are empty, the PROXY protocol support is disabled.

func main() {
app := &cli.App{
Name: "sshpiperd",
Usage: "the missing reverse proxy for ssh scp",
UsageText: "sshpiperd [options] <plugin1> [plugin options] [-- [plugin2] [plugin options] [-- ...]]",
Description: "sshpiperd works as a proxy-like ware, and route connections by username, src ip , etc.\nhttps://github.com/tg123/sshpiper",
Version: version(),
Flags: []cli.Flag{
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"address",
Aliases: []string{"l"},
Value: "0.0.0.0",
Usage: "listening address",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_ADDRESS"},
},
&cli.IntFlag{
Name: "port",
Aliases: []string{"p"},
Value: 2222,
Usage: "listening port",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_PORT"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"server-key",
Aliases: []string{"i"},
Usage: "server key files, support wildcard",
Value: "/etc/ssh/ssh_host_ed25519_key",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_SERVER_KEY"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"server-key-data",
Usage: "server key in base64 format, server-key, server-key-generate-mode will be ignored if set",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_SERVER_KEY_DATA"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"server-key-generate-mode",
Usage: "server key generate mode, one of: disable, notexist, always. generated key will be written to `server-key` if notexist or always",
Value: "disable",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_SERVER_KEY_GENERATE_MODE"},
},
&cli.DurationFlag{
Name: "login-grace-time",
Value: 30 * time.Second,
Usage: "sshpiperd forcely close the connection after this time if the pipe has not successfully established",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_LOGIN_GRACE_TIME"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"log-level",
Value: "info",
Usage: "log level, one of: trace, debug, info, warn, error, fatal, panic",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_LOG_LEVEL"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"log-format",
Value: "text",
Usage: "log format, one of: text, json",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_LOG_FORMAT"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"typescript-log-dir",
Value: "",
Usage: "create typescript format screen recording and save into the directory see https://linux.die.net/man/1/script",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_TYPESCRIPT_LOG_DIR"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"banner-text",
Value: "",
Usage: "display a banner before authentication, would be ignored if banner file was set",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_BANNERTEXT"},
},
&cli.StringFlag{
Name: "banner-file",
Value: "",
Usage: "display a banner from file before authentication",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_BANNERFILE"},
},
&cli.BoolFlag{
Name: "drop-hostkeys-message",
Value: false,
Usage: "filter out hostkeys-00@openssh.com which cause client side warnings",
EnvVars: []string{"SSHPIPERD_DROP_HOSTKEYS_MESSAGE"},
},
&cli.StringSliceFlag{
Name: "allowed-proxy-addresses",
Value: cli.NewStringSlice(),
Usage: "allowed proxy addresses, only connections from these ip ranges are allowed to send a proxy header based on the PROXY protocol, empty will disable the PROXY protocol support",
},
},
